Saturday, July 16, 2022

Can the Detroit Lions cause ‘chaos’ in the NFC North this year?

 Link: https://sidelionreport.com/2022/07/16/can-detroit-lions-cause-chaos-nfc-north-year/

No comments:

Post a Comment